The Time Has Come by Anne Briggs.

Rating:

Performer Notes: Anne Briggs's celebrated 1969 debut consisted entirely of traditional British folk songs, but on 1971's THE TIME HAS COME, the U.K. folk legend began writing her own material. Still rooted in the sound and sensibility of traditional British folk, the 13 songs on THE TIME HAS COME are performed with minimal acoustic guitar instead of her debut's a cappella sound. Highlights include the title track, which Briggs had previously given to the Pentangle for one of their early albums, and the haunting "Fire and Wine." This Water Records reissue features no bonus tracks, but has been carefully remastered.

Professional Reviews: Uncut (p.94) - 4 stars out of 5 -- "Blessed with a skylark of a voice that was usually unaccompanied, Briggs would inhabit a song rather than deliver it note perfect."

Dirty Linen (p.75) - "Brimming with memorable songs like the title tune and the haunting 'Sandman's Song,' THE TIME HAS COME sounds as eerie and timeless today as it did back in 1971."

Mojo (Publisher) (p.74) - "[A] set of intimate, mostly self-penned songs of love, nature and wanderlust."
